- Title
Gangrene caused by topically applied home-prepared aconite liniment.
- Authors
Zhang, Dongmei; Cheng, Liqing; Wu, Yaguang; Zhou, Cunjian; Shen, Zhu
- Abstract
The article presents a case study of a 68-year-old man presented with a history of progressive dry gangrene and ulceration of the left lower leg after self-medication with wet compresses soaked of home-prepared aconite tincture from rhizomes of A. carmichaelii. Topics include reporting of aconite poisoning following poor processing of raw materials, home-made tincture causing vasoconstriction and plant species exert such activity sue to common active components of aconitine-type alkaloids.
